Sorrento Lemon Sauce

ITALIAN · SAUCE · SERVES 4

Experience a burst of Mediterranean sunshine with this Sorrento Lemon Sauce, a tangy and creamy delight that elevates any dish. This sauce, inspired by the coastal town of Sorrento in Italy, is a luscious blend of fresh lemons, aromatic garlic, and rich cream, making it perfect for drizzling over pasta, grilled fish, or roasted vegetables. The vibrant flavors not only brighten your meal but also transport you to the sun-kissed shores of Italy with every bite.

Ingredients

Original recipe serves 4

Unsalted butter
2 tablespoons
Garlic
2 cloves, minced
Fresh lemon juice
1/4 cup
Lemon zest
1 tablespoon
Heavy cream
1 cup
Salt
to taste
Black pepper
to taste
Fresh parsley
1/4 cup, chopped

Instructions

  1. In a small saucepan, melt the unsalted butter over medium heat until bubbly.
  2. Add the minced garlic to the pan, cooking for 1-2 minutes until fragrant and golden, being careful not to burn it.
  3. Stir in the lemon zest and fresh lemon juice, mixing well to combine all the flavors.
  4. Pour in the heavy cream, stirring continuously as the mixture begins to heat through.
  5. Reduce the heat to low and let the sauce simmer gently for 5 minutes, allowing it to thicken slightly.
  6. Season with salt and freshly cracked black pepper to taste.
  7. Remove the saucepan from heat and stir in the chopped fresh parsley for a burst of color and freshness.
  8. Serve the Sorrento Lemon Sauce warm over your choice of pasta, grilled fish, or roasted vegetables for a delightful meal.

Tips

  • 💡 For a spicier kick, add a pinch of red pepper flakes while cooking the garlic.
  • 💡 This sauce can be made ahead of time; simply reheat gently before serving.
  • 💡 Feel free to experiment with other herbs, such as basil or dill, to customize the flavor profile.
